Cleaning is a big one for parents. Our baby products are dishwasher safe because we use a higher-grade silicone that does not break down under repeated high-heat cycles. Cheaper materials get cloudy and sticky after a few months in the dishwasher.

Teethers need to be soft enough for sore gums but tough enough to survive being thrown across a room. Shore A 40 to 50 is the sweet spot for most teething products. Go softer and they tear. Go harder and babies lose interest.
